Given below are certain cations. Using inorganic qualitative analysis, arrange them in increasing group number from 0 to \(\mathrm{VI}\). \(A\). \(Al^{3+}\)  \(B\). \(Cu^{2+}\)  \(C\). \(Ba^{2+}\)    \(D\). \(Co^{2+}\)  \(E\). \(Mg^{2+}\) Choose the correct answer from the options given below.

  1. A  \(B, C, A, D, E\)
  2. B  \(E, C, D, B, A\)
  3. C \(E, A, B, C, D\)
  4. D  \(B, A, D, C, E\)

Correct Answer

(D)  \(B, A, D, C, E\)

Step-by-step Solution

Detailed explanation

Group Cations
Group \(-II\) \(\mathrm{Cu}^{2+}\)
Group \(-III\) \(\mathrm{Al}^{3+}\)
Group \(-IV\) \(\mathrm{Co}^{2+}\)
Group \(-V\) \(\mathrm{Ba}^{2+}\)
Group \(-VI\) \(\mathrm{Mg}^{2+}\)
The correct order of group number of ions is \(\underset{\text { (B) }}{\mathrm{Cu}^{2+}} < \underset{\text { (A) }}{\mathrm{Al}^{3+}} < \underset{\text { (D) }}{\mathrm{Co}^{2+}} < \underset{\text { (C) }}{\mathrm{Ba}^{2+}} < \underset{\text { (E) }}{\mathrm{Mg}^{2+}}\) \(\therefore\) The correct order is \(\mathrm{B}, \mathrm{A}, \mathrm{D}, \mathrm{C}, \mathrm{E}\)
